ItGo.me - 专注IT技术分享

首页 > Spring > Spring Security > Spring Security(10)——退出登录logout

Spring Security(10)——退出登录logout

时间:2016-02-21来源:网友分享 点击:

       要实现退出登录的功能我们需要在http元素下定义logout元素,这样Spring Security将自动为我们添加用于处理退出登录的过滤器LogoutFilterFilterChain。当我们指定了http元素的auto-config属性为truelogout定义是会自动配置的,此时我们默认退出登录的URL为“/j_spring_security_logout”,可以通过logout元素的logout-url属性来改变退出登录的默认地址。

   <security:logout logout-url="/logout.do"/>

 

       此外,我们还可以给logout指定如下属性:

属性名

作用

invalidate-session

表示是否要在退出登录后让当前session失效,默认为true

delete-cookies

指定退出登录后需要删除的cookie名称,多个cookie之间以逗号分隔。

logout-success-url

指定成功退出登录后要重定向的URL。需要注意的是对应的URL应当是不需要登录就可以访问的。

success-handler-ref

指定用来处理成功退出登录的LogoutSuccessHandler的引用。

 

(注:本文是基于Spring Security3.1.6所写)

 

 (注:原创文章,转载请注明出处。原文地址:http://haohaoxuexi.iteye.com/blog/2162334)


Spring Security(19)——对Acl的支持

对 Acl 的支持   目录 1.1            准备工作 1.2            表功能介绍 1.2.1      表 acl_sid 1.2.2      表 acl_class 1.2.3      表 acl_object_identity 1.2.4      表 acl_entry 1.3         ...

Spring Security(09)——Filter

Filter 目录 1.1      Filter 顺序 1.2      添加 Filter 到 FilterChain 1.3      DelegatingFilterProxy 1.4      FilterChainProxy 1.5      Spring Security 定义好的核心 Filter 1.5.1     FilterSecurityInterceptor 1.5.2  ...

Spring Security(10)——退出登录logout

        要实现退出登录的功能我们需要在 http 元素下定义 logout 元素,这样 Spring Security 将自动为我们添加用于处理退出登录的过滤器 LogoutFilter 到 FilterChain 。当我们指定了 http 元素的 auto-...

        要实现退出登录的功能我们需要在 http 元素下定义 logout 元素,这样 Spring Security 将自动为我们添加用于处理退出登录的过滤器 LogoutFilter 到 FilterChain 。当我们指定了 http 元素的 auto-
------分隔线----------------------------
推荐文章